Rajni purchased a mobile phone and a refrigerator for Rs. 12000 and Rs. 10000 respectively. She sold the refrigerator at a loss of 12 percent and the mobile phone at a profit of 8 percent. What is her overall loss/profit? `Los s\ of\ R s .280` b. `Los s\ of\ R s .240` c. `P rofi t\ of\ R s .2060` d. `P rofi t\ of\ R s .2160` e. none of these
